NBA -- Hawks edge Bulls, win 10 of their last 11


PhilBoxing.com




CHICAGO -- On the second night of a back-to-back, the Chicago Bulls couldn't keep up with the streaking Atlanta Hawks.

Al Horford filled the stats sheet with 21 points, 10 rebounds and six assists to lead Atlanta to a hard-fought 93-86 win on Monday night at the Philips Arena. Paul Millsap added 17 while Jeff Teague and Kyle Korver each had 12 for the Hawks, who won 10 of their last 11 outings.

It was the Hawks' 10th victory in 11 games and they now soar to third place in the Eastern Conference with a 17-7 won-lost slate.

"The Bulls, who walloped the Miami Heat, 93-75 on Sunday night at the American Airlines Arena, saw all it starters finish in double figures with Jimmy Butler leading the way with 22. But Chicago made only 35 of 93 shots (37.6 percent) and dropped just 6-of-29 triples (20.7 percent).

Taj Gibson had 15 for the Bulls while Derrick Rose finished with 14 and eight assists. Pau Gasol chipped in 13 and 12 boards while Mike Dunleavy settled for 11. Chicago dropped to 15-9, fourth place in the East. (HP)

Photo: Al Horford (middle) led the Hawks charge with 21 points and Atlanta held off the Bulls, 93-86 on Monday night.
